Why Auto Air Conditioning Recharge Kit Is Necessary

I’ve found that an auto air conditioning recharge kit is necessary because my car’s AC system can slowly lose refrigerant over time. When that happens, the air stops blowing as cold as it should, and driving in hot weather becomes uncomfortable fast. Using a recharge kit helps me restore cooling performance without having to visit a shop right away.

I also like that it gives me a simple way to keep my AC working efficiently. When the refrigerant level is low, my AC has to work harder, which can reduce performance and put extra strain on the system. A recharge kit helps me maintain proper cooling, improve comfort, and avoid bigger problems later.

Another reason I consider it necessary is convenience. I can check and recharge my AC on my own when I notice weak cooling, instead of waiting for an appointment. For me, that means saving time, staying comfortable, and keeping my vehicle ready for everyday driving.

My Buying Guides on Auto Air Conditioning Recharge Kit

What I Look For First

When I shop for an auto air conditioning recharge kit, my first priority is compatibility. I always make sure the kit matches my vehicle’s refrigerant type, because using the wrong one can cause poor performance or even damage the system. I also check whether the kit is designed for R-134a, R-1234yf, or another specific refrigerant before I buy.

Ease of Use

I prefer a kit that is simple to connect and easy to read. A clear pressure gauge, an easy-to-use hose, and a straightforward trigger or valve make the process much less stressful. If I can recharge my AC without needing special tools or professional help, that is a big plus for me.

What’s Included in the Kit

I always review what comes in the package. Some kits include only the refrigerant can and hose, while others come with a gauge, sealant, leak detector, or even a temperature guide. For me, a better kit is one that includes everything I need for a basic recharge in one box.

Pressure Gauge Quality

The pressure gauge matters a lot to me because it helps me avoid overcharging the system. I look for a gauge that is easy to read, accurate, and durable. A low-quality gauge can make the whole job confusing, so I like one with clear markings and reliable performance.

Safety Features

I never ignore safety. I look for kits with safety valves, secure hose connections, and clear instructions. Since AC systems are pressurized, I want a kit that helps me work carefully and reduces the chance of leaks or mistakes.

Leak Sealer or Stop-Leak Additives

If I suspect a small leak, I may consider a kit with leak sealer. However, I use this feature carefully because it is not a permanent fix. For me, leak sealer is only helpful for minor issues, and I still prefer to inspect the system if the AC keeps losing refrigerant.
